Hello Peeeetertje , I examined the classpath and noticed, that there are two versions of org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.xquery.saxon.XBeansXQuery, one with 3-paramters constructor in xmlbeans-xpath-2.6.0.jar and one with a 4-parameters constructor in xmlbeans-3.1.1-sb-fixed.jar. According to the exception the latter one is intended to be used, while the first one comes first in the classpath. It seems to me that xmlbeans-xpath-2.6.0.jar was accidentially packed into SoapUI 5.6.0 by SmartBear. There is only a single second class org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.xpath.saxon.XBeansXPath in that jar, but this seems to be identical to the version in xmlbeans-3.1.1-sb-fixed.jar. My solution (macOS): Rename xmlbeans-xpath-2.6.0.jar to xmlbeans-xpath-2.6.0.txt in /Applications/SoapUI-5.6.0.app/Contents/java/app/lib/. Works for me, no further sideeffects noticed so far. cheers kacperwniczykfyi2.1KViews1like4Comments
